首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在typescipt中使用带有混合类型的类

在TypeScript中使用带有混合类型的类可以通过以下步骤实现:

  1. 定义一个类,并在类中声明混合类型的属性和方法。混合类型是指一个类既具有实例属性和方法,又具有静态属性和方法。
代码语言:txt
复制
class MixedClass {
  static staticProperty: string;
  instanceProperty: number;

  static staticMethod() {
    // 静态方法的实现
  }

  instanceMethod() {
    // 实例方法的实现
  }
}
  1. 创建类的实例,并使用实例属性和方法。
代码语言:txt
复制
const instance = new MixedClass();
instance.instanceProperty = 10;
instance.instanceMethod();
  1. 直接使用类的静态属性和方法。
代码语言:txt
复制
MixedClass.staticProperty = "Hello";
MixedClass.staticMethod();

混合类型的类在实际开发中有很多应用场景,例如:

  • 在前端开发中,可以使用混合类型的类来管理全局状态或共享数据。
  • 在后端开发中,可以使用混合类型的类来封装公共的工具函数或服务。
  • 在软件测试中,可以使用混合类型的类来模拟复杂的测试场景或生成测试数据。
  • 在人工智能领域,可以使用混合类型的类来定义复杂的神经网络结构或算法模型。

腾讯云提供了一系列与云计算相关的产品,以下是一些推荐的产品和对应的介绍链接:

  • 云服务器(CVM):提供可扩展的计算能力,支持多种操作系统和应用场景。产品介绍链接
  • 云数据库 MySQL 版(CDB):提供高性能、可扩展的关系型数据库服务。产品介绍链接
  • 云原生容器服务(TKE):提供高可用、弹性伸缩的容器集群管理服务。产品介绍链接
  • 云存储(COS):提供安全、可靠的对象存储服务,适用于各种数据存储需求。产品介绍链接
  • 人工智能机器学习平台(AI Lab):提供丰富的人工智能算法和模型训练平台。产品介绍链接

希望以上信息能够满足您的需求,如果还有其他问题,请随时提问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

7分14秒

Go 语言读写 Excel 文档

1.2K
9分19秒

036.go的结构体定义

7分8秒

059.go数组的引入

48秒

手持读数仪功能简单介绍说明

领券